Cabin Demolition in Conroe, TX
Cabin demolition services involve the careful removal and disposal of existing cabins, whether they are small structures or larger, more complex buildings. This type of project typically includes tearing down the entire cabin, clearing the site, and managing debris removal to prepare the property for future use or development. Homeowners often request cabin demolition when they want to replace an outdated or damaged structure, clear land for new construction, or remove a building that no longer serves their needs.
Property owners considering cabin demolition should understand key factors such as the size and construction materials of the cabin, any potential permits required, and the condition of the site. It’s important to evaluate access to the property, proximity to neighboring structures, and the presence of utilities that may need to be disconnected before demolition begins. Proper planning ensures that the project can proceed smoothly and efficiently, helping property owners achieve their goals with minimal disruption.

Cabin Demolition Questions
What types of cabins can be demolished? Cabin demolition services typically handle various structures, including small lakeside cabins, seasonal retreats, and larger vacation homes.
Is preparation needed before demolition? Property owners should ensure clear access to the cabin and remove any personal belongings or hazardous materials beforehand.
What happens to the debris after demolition? Debris is usually cleared from the site and disposed of according to local regulations, with options for recycling materials when possible.
Are permits required for cabin demolition? Permit requirements depend on local regulations; contacting the appropriate authorities can clarify necessary approvals.
